Advertisement
RieqyNS13

Untitled

Jan 24th, 2013
269
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
PHP 1.85 KB | None | 0 0
  1. /*
  2. Name  : Data_Insert.php & Hash_Crack.php
  3. Coder : RieqyNS13
  4. */
  5.  
  6. <?php
  7. /*Data Insert*/
  8. set_time_limit(0);
  9. $con = mysql_connect("localhost","root","");
  10. if (!$con)
  11. {
  12. die( mysql_error());
  13. }
  14. mysql_select_db("hash", $con);
  15. $lines=file('wordlist.txt');
  16. $line=array_unique(str_replace(array("\n", "\r", "\r\n"),'',$lines));
  17. foreach($line as $line){
  18. $sql = mysql_query("SELECT string FROM md5 WHERE string='$line';");
  19. if(mysql_num_rows($sql)>=1){
  20.     continue;
  21. }else{
  22.     ob_start();
  23.     mysql_query("INSERT INTO md5(string) VALUES ('$line');");
  24.     echo $line."\n";
  25.     $hasil = ob_get_contents();
  26.     ob_end_clean();
  27.     echo $hasil;
  28.     }
  29. }
  30. mysql_close($con);
  31. ?>
  32. --------------------------------------------------------------------------------
  33. <?php
  34. /*Hash Crack*/
  35. $kon = mysql_connect('127.0.0.1' ,'root', '') or die(mysql_error());
  36. mysql_select_db('hash', $kon) or die(mysql_error());
  37. $file = file("hash_list.lst");
  38. $str = array_unique(str_replace(array("\n", "\r", "\r\n"), "" , $file));
  39. foreach($str as $ke){
  40.     $key = trim($ke);
  41.     $sql1 = mysql_query("SELECT string FROM md5 WHERE hash = '$key';");
  42.     $sql2 = mysql_query("SELECT string FROM sha1 WHERE hash = '$key';");
  43.     $row = mysql_fetch_array($sql1);
  44.     $row2 = mysql_fetch_array($sql2);
  45.     if(mysql_num_rows($sql1)>=1 && mysql_num_rows($sql2)>=0){
  46.         ob_start();
  47.         echo $key.":".$row['string']."\n";
  48.         $crack = ob_get_contents();
  49.         ob_end_clean();
  50.         echo $crack;
  51.     }
  52.     if(mysql_num_rows($sql1)>=0 && mysql_num_rows($sql2)>=1){
  53.         ob_start();
  54.         echo $key.":".$row2['string']."\n";
  55.         $crack = ob_get_contents();
  56.         ob_end_clean();
  57.         echo $crack;
  58.         }
  59.     /*Jika tidak ada*/
  60.     if(mysql_num_rows($sql1)==0 && mysql_num_rows($sql2)==0){
  61.         echo $key.":"."HASH NOT FOUND"."\n";
  62.         ob_start();
  63.         $crack = ob_get_contents();
  64.         ob_end_clean();
  65.         echo $crack;
  66.         }
  67. }
  68. mysql_close($kon);
  69. ?>
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ement